Long weekends in Portugal, 2027
7 long weekends of three or more days, and 4 where taking one extra day off makes a longer break.
Long weekends
- 3 daysFriday 1 January 2027 – Sunday 3 January 2027
Ano Novo
- 4 days*Saturday 6 February 2027 – Tuesday 9 February 2027
Carnaval
💡 Take off for this 4-day break.
- 3 daysFriday 26 March 2027 – Sunday 28 March 2027
Sexta-feira Santa, Domingo de Páscoa
- 4 days*Thursday 27 May 2027 – Sunday 30 May 2027
Corpo de Deus
💡 Take off for this 4-day break.
- 4 days*Thursday 10 June 2027 – Sunday 13 June 2027
Dia de Portugal, de Camões e das Comunidades Portuguesas
💡 Take off for this 4-day break.
- 4 days*Saturday 2 October 2027 – Tuesday 5 October 2027
Implantação da República
💡 Take off for this 4-day break.
- 3 daysSaturday 30 October 2027 – Monday 1 November 2027
Dia de Todos-os-Santos

A long weekend here means three or more consecutive non-working days — weekends plus any public holiday that touches them. Entries marked * aren't automatic: they need the one marked day of leave to happen. Everything assumes a standard Saturday–Sunday weekend and a five-day week, and counts nationwide public holidays only — confirm your own leave rules and any regional holidays before booking.
